Radiology Technologist Lead - McLaren Careers
**Dept:** Diagnostic Radiology **Schedule:** 7am-330pm **Hours Per Biweekly Pay Period:** 80 #LI-CM1 **Position Summary:** Performs a variety of imaging procedures consistent with established policies and procedures at a technical level typically requiring general supervision. **Essential Functions and Responsibilities** **:** 1. Gives straightforward explanations and instructions to foster a sense of comfort and confidence to patients and ensure the needs of individual patients are met. 2. Operates and maintains all assigned imaging department equipment including but not limited to x-ray. 3. Positions patients and uses radiologic equipment to correctly capture the images requested by a physician. 4. Accurately performs all imaging exams as ordered in accordance with established policies, procedures, regulations, and laws; ensures the physician on duty is notified of the results. 5. Completes quality assurance processes and practices radiation safety in order to reduce exposure to patients, staff and self. 6. Maintains all required documentation, logs, charts, forms and records in paper and electronic formats. 7. Maintains an adequate supply of all consumables to perform quality testing. 8. Performs all routine daily, weekly, monthly, and periodic maintenance and function checks following established protocol for all imaging equipment. **Lead** **Essential Functions and Responsibilities** **:** 1. Assists in quality control and performance improvement activities. 2. Contributes to performance feedback, hiring decisions. 3. Ensures standards are met (quality, timeliness, customer service, etc.). 4. Evaluates and tests new procedures/processes. 5. Orients and/or trains new staff. 6. Problem solving capabilities. 7. Subject matter expert/technical leadership. 8. Work flow/distribution of work. 9. Assists in assuring compliance with all regulatory and other agency requirements, laws, and statutes pertaining to the operation of the department. **Qualifications:** **Required:** + High School diploma or GED + Graduation from an AMA-approved school of Radiology Technology + Certified in general radiologic technology by the American Registry of Radiologic Technology (ARRT) + Current BLS certification **Preferred:** + Associate’s Degree in radiology
